The global consumer goods and specialized "eco-design" landscape of early 2026 is defined by a rigorous focus on "recyclability-by-design" and the maintenance of high-performance barrier standards. Germany’s plastics market has emerged as a foundational technology in this environment, where the shift toward Post-Consumer Recycled (PCR) resins and Bio-based Plastics is accelerating. Valued for their exceptional ability to provide food-safe protection with a reduced carbon footprint—a factor driving Packaging toward a dominant 35% market share—these materials are essential for the "safety-first" supply chain in the European FMCG sector. As Germany implements more stringent "Plastic Tax" regulations, the role of Mono-material Barrier Films has become paramount for providing the biochemical and mechanical foundations of modern, high-cycle retail distribution.

According to a recent report by Market Research Future, the Germany Plastics Market is witnessing a transformative era of growth driven by the expansion of the global sustainable packaging, healthcare, and specialized construction sectors. The market is projected to reach a significant valuation by 2032, reflecting the surge in demand for Bioplastics like PLA and PHA, which are recording a higher CAGR than traditional resins. This trajectory is a central focus of the latest Germany Plastics Market Forecast, which identifies Injection Molding as the primary processing technology, while the Construction segment is recording gains due to the demand for high-efficiency polymer insulation and window profiles.

Looking toward 2035, the market is poised to be redefined by "High-Resolution Chemical Recycling (Pyrolysis)" and the expansion of the "mass-balance-certified-polymer" niche. We are seeing a significant move toward the development of advanced recycling facilities that convert hard-to-recycle plastic waste back into virgin-quality monomers, helping brands align with tightening global ESG mandates and the EU’s Circular Economy Action Plan. Additionally, the move toward "Digital Product Passports"—utilizing blockchain to track the recycled content and carbon intensity of plastic components—is helping the industry achieve its long-term objective of total material transparency. By 2035, the market will likely be defined by Ecological Integrity, providing the essential, low-impact, and high-fidelity material foundations required to support a more technologically advanced and resource-conscious global industrial infrastructure.
